怎样训练ai网洛防御模型
时间: 2023-06-10 11:07:42 浏览: 49
训练AI网络防御模型需要以下步骤:
1. 数据收集:收集各种类型的网络攻击数据,包括恶意软件、网络钓鱼、DDoS攻击等等。这些数据可以通过各种方式收集,例如使用网络捕获工具、安全设备的日志、虚拟机等等。
2. 数据预处理:对数据进行清洗和预处理,包括去除噪声、标准化、归一化等等,以便于后续的特征提取和模型训练。
3. 特征提取:从预处理的数据中提取有意义的特征,以便于训练模型。这些特征可以是统计特征、时间序列特征、频域特征、空间特征等等。
4. 模型选择:选择适合任务的机器学习或深度学习模型。常用的模型包括随机森林、支持向量机、卷积神经网络等等。
5. 模型训练:使用预处理的数据和特征,训练选定的模型。这个过程需要调整模型的超参数,以提高模型的性能。
6. 模型评估:使用测试数据集评估模型的性能,包括准确度、召回率、F1值等等。如果模型的性能不够好,需要重新调整模型的超参数或者更换模型。
7. 模型部署:将训练好的模型部署到实际的网络环境中,以便于实时检测和防御网络攻击。
需要注意的是,网络防御模型的训练是一个迭代的过程,需要不断地优化和改进。同时,网络攻击的方式也在不断地演变,所以需要及时更新模型,以应对新的攻击方式。
相关问题
恶意代码分析人工智能模型
恶意代码分析人工智能模型是指使用人工智能技术,通过对恶意代码进行分析和学习,自动识别和分类恶意代码。这种模型可以帮助安全专家更快速、准确地检测和应对新型恶意软件,提高网络安全防御的效率和精度。通过分析恶意代码的特征、行为和漏洞等信息,这种模型可以自动学习和识别新的恶意软件类型,帮助安全专家及时发现和应对网络威胁,保护网络安全。
网络空间安全与人工智能
网络空间安全与人工智能之间存在着密切的关系。人工智能在网络空间安全中发挥着重要的作用,同时也面临着一些挑战。
首先,人工智能可以应用于网络空间安全的各个方面。例如,人工智能可以用于网络入侵检测和防御,通过分析大量的网络流量数据,快速发现并阻止潜在的攻击行为。此外,人工智能还可以用于恶意软件的检测和清除,通过学习和识别恶意软件的行为模式,及时发现并应对新型威胁。另外,人工智能还可以用于加密算法的设计和密码学的研究,提高网络通信的安全性。
然而,人工智能在网络空间安全中也面临一些挑战。首先是数据隐私和安全性的问题。在使用人工智能进行网络安全分析时,需要大量的数据进行训练和学习,但这些数据可能包含敏感信息,如用户隐私等。因此,在应用人工智能技术时,需要采取相应的数据保护措施,确保数据的安全性和隐私性。其次,人工智能系统本身也可能存在漏洞和被攻击的风险。黑客可以利用人工智能系统中的弱点进行攻击,如对抗学习、数据篡改等。
为了解决上述问题,需要在网络空间安全与人工智能的交叉领域进行深入研究和合作。例如,可以研究开发更加安全和隐私保护的人工智能算法和模型;加强对人工智能系统的安全性评估和审计;制定相应的法律法规和政策,保障数据的安全和隐私。
总之,网络空间安全与人工智能密切相关,人工智能在提升网络空间安全方面具有巨大潜力,同时也需要解决一些安全和隐私保护的问题。